Recently noticed that this very much loved tree in my backyard has this puddle at the base of its trunk that hasn’t gone away. I think it’s been there for a month perhaps more. It also has this black section of bark, but that has been there for years. The tree appears to otherwise be thriving, but it just occurred to me that maybe this is some type of disease. If so, I’d love to take care of it because this tree is a big part of our life and we love it.

Expert Response

The good news is it is rarely fatal or even deleterious. There is no cure, one needs to give the tree the right amount of water and keep it healthy. Make sure the tree gets about 5 gallons of water per week and check the soil moisture under the tree at a depth of 4 inches before watering. The soil should be moist but not bone dry or soggy.
